Hook to Dunfermline City by train

A train trip from Hook to Dunfermline City takes about 8hrs 1 mins on average, covering roughly 346 miles (557 kilometres). With around 16 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£58.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Hook to Dunfermline City start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Hook to Dunfermline City start from £107.50 one way, or £231.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Hook to Dunfermline City are available for £212.00 one way, or £448.70 return

Facilities and Amenities at Hook Station

Hook Train Station is equipped with essential facilities to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. Tickets can be easily purchased and collected at the station's ticket machines, which are accessible to all and compatible with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. While there's no staff assistance available onsite, the station offers information via help points and screens displaying departure details.

The waiting room is a cozy retreat, heated for those chilly days and open from Monday to Saturday, creating a pleasant environment as you wait for your train. Accessibility is taken seriously at Hook; step-free access is available, catering to those with mobility needs, though it's worth noting the separate entrances for each platform.

Additionally, the station offers ample bicycle storage, making it a great choice for environmentally conscious travellers who prefer to cycle to their destination. However, do note that amenities such as refreshment facilities, shops, and ATMs are not available within the station premises, so planning ahead for snacks or cash withdrawal is wise.

Facilities and Amenities at Dunfermline City Station

Dunfermline City station offers a range of facilities designed to enhance your travel experience. The ticket office operates from early morning until evening, Monday through Saturday, providing ample opportunity for passengers to purchase or collect their tickets. With the option to collect tickets from ticket machines, and all machines being accessible, ease of access is a priority. The station also features a handy induction loop for those with hearing impairments.

The ticket office and customer service teams are readily available to assist with inquiries, while real-time departure and arrival screens keep you informed on train schedules. You’ll find comfortable waiting rooms on both platforms, although note that opening hours vary. Plus, there are accessible toilets, baby-changing facilities, and news kiosks for your convenience. For added peace of mind, the station is equipped with CCTV and offers free parking facilities with available blue badge spaces.
